WebFor drug development, the clinical phases start with testing for drug safety in a few human subjects, then expand to many study participants (potentially tens of … WebJun 23, 2016 · biotechnology executive experienced in leading global, multi-cultural teams responsible for bringing a wide variety of protein … WebThis paper illustrates an approach to setting the decision framework for a study in early clinical drug development. It shows how the criteria for a go and a stop decision are calculated based on pre-specified target and lower reference values. The framework can lead to a three-outcome approach by i … mot cnc works

Drug development is the process of bringing a novel drug from “bench to bedside”. It can take 10 to 15 years for a drug to be designed, developed and approved for use in patients (Fig 1). In some circumstances, the drug development and approval process can be expedited – for example, if the drug is the first available …
